1976 Chevrolet Caprice vs. 1996 Nissan Primera

To start off, 1996 Nissan Primera is newer by 20 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Chevrolet Caprice.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Chevrolet Caprice would be higher. At 5,000 cc (8 cylinders), 1976 Chevrolet Caprice is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Nissan Primera (148 HP @ 6100 RPM) has 3 more horse power than 1976 Chevrolet Caprice. (145 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1996 Nissan Primera should accelerate faster than 1976 Chevrolet Caprice.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1976 Chevrolet Caprice weights approximately 450 kg more than 1996 Nissan Primera.

Because 1976 Chevrolet Caprice is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1976 Chevrolet Caprice.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1996 Nissan Primera,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1976 Chevrolet Caprice (332 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 151 more torque (in Nm) than 1996 Nissan Primera. (181 Nm @ 4800 RPM). This means 1976 Chevrolet Caprice will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1996 Nissan Primera. 1976 Chevrolet Caprice has automatic transmission and 1996 Nissan Primera has manual transmission. 1996 Nissan Primera will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1976 Chevrolet Caprice will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1976 Chevrolet Caprice 1996 Nissan Primera
Make Chevrolet Nissan
Model Caprice Primera
Year Released 1976 1996
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5000 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 145 HP 148 HP
Engine RPM 3800 RPM 6100 RPM
Torque 332 Nm 181 Nm
Torque RPM 2400 RPM 4800 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Vehicle Weight 1720 kg 1270 kg
Vehicle Length 5390 mm 4410 mm
Vehicle Width 1920 mm 1710 mm
Vehicle Height 1430 mm 1400 mm
Wheelbase Size 2950 mm 2610 mm
